Understanding electric vehicle cables


Electric vehicle cables are carriers that connect electric vehicles and charging piles, and their basic function is to transfer electric energy. However, with the development of charging technology, in order to better complete the charging process, good communication should be established between electric vehicles and charging piles, and automatic adjustment should be made if necessary. Therefore, the charging process imposes higher requirements on the charging cable. The charging cable not only needs to have the function of transmitting electricity, but also needs to transmit the status and information of the car and power battery to the charging pile for real-time interaction. If necessary, the charging response should be adjusted to safely and reliably complete the charging process.


What are the common reasons for problems with electric vehicle cables?


  • Unqualified structure. The thinnest point of the insulation layer is lower than the minimum value specified by the standard, or the average thickness is lower than the nominal value, and there is a risk of breakdown when used.

  • Unqualified cross-linking degree. If the cross-linking degree fails to meet the standard, the cable's heat resistance is unqualified, and it cannot meet the requirement of allowing a short circuit of 250℃ under normal work temperature of 90℃, which greatly reduces the electrical performance.

  • Bamboo-like appearance. The thickness of the electric vehicle cable is uneven, and the appearance of the electric vehicle cable is bamboo-like. Due to the different cross-sectional areas of each section of the electric vehicle cable, the heating of the electric vehicle cable is uneven, which affects the insulation life.

  • Surface scratches. Under normal circumstances, electric vehicle cables with surface scratches will be eliminated during the testing process and will not be on the market. However, electric vehicle cables may still be scratched by foreign objects during transportation or laying. Therefore, before use, the insulation of electric vehicle cables must be checked for integrity. Normal electric wires and electric vehicle cables that have been put into operation have a long service life and have reached the end of their service life. The insulation resistance of the electric wire and the insulation resistance of the center head decrease year by year and cannot reach the standard value, which can also cause quality problems.

  • Electric vehicle cables often operate at full load, which leads to the center temperature being too high due to the thermal effect of the current. The center insulation of the electric vehicle cable deteriorates often due to frequent large current shock load or problems with electrical equipment, resulting in cold and hot center insulation, frequent temperature changes, and large temperature differences, causing the insulation to deform and become brittle and the center insulation to deteriorate.
